[more ▼] The automated enrichment of mass-digitised document collections using techniques such as text mining is becoming increasingly popular. Enriched collections offer new opportunities for interface design to allow data-driven and visualisation-based search, exploration and interpretation. Most such interfaces integrate close and distant reading and represent semantic, spatial, social or temporal relations, but often lack contrastive views. Inspect and Compare (I\&C) contributes to the current state of the art in interface design for historical newspapers with highly versatile side-by-side comparisons of query results and curated article sets based on metadata and semantic enrichments. I\&C takes search queries and pre-curated article sets as inputs and allows comparisons based on the distributions of newspaper titles, publication dates and automatically generated enrichments, such as language, article types, topics and named entities. Contrastive views of such data reveal patterns, help humanities scholars to improve search strategies and to facilitate a critical assessment of the overall data quality. I\&C is part of the impresso interface for the exploration of digitised and semantically enriched historical newspapers. [more ▼] Defining and managing teaching programs at universities or other institutions is a complex task for which there is not much support in terms of methods and tools. This task becomes even more critical when the time comes to obtain certifications w.r.t. official standards. In this paper, we present an on-going project called TESMA, whose objective is to provide an open-source tool dedicated to the specification and management (including certification) of teaching programs. An in-depth market analysis regarding related tools and conceptual frameworks of the project is presented.
